    Guys this version of Fiat 126 is called BIS - is a upgrade version of stock 126 it has biger engine -700CC ( 650 in regular) Engine is liquid cooling (air cooled in reg.)and laing flat, diffrent steering rack, 13"wheels (12" reg) and rear trunk, not only a engine compartment like in regular one:) ( trunk in regular is only on front) This engine is transfered for his succesor fiat chinquacento.

    Foam back on the headliner is a no go. It will get moist and moist to long so that the roof will actually get heavily rusty!
    The original 126 from Italy came with a headliner with room for air between the liner and the roof to keep it breathing.
    Seat well done. But there are new covers on the market. Or just swap the seats.
    Normally you take out the engine and the gearbox all at ones. The rubbers of the axle/gearbox are most likely leaking oil too. That's a common point to check and change.
    Block and head are both aluminium so one may wonder why the coolant was that rusty (?). My guess is that there was some oil deposits in the coolant.
    All that sanding of the rims. Absolutely not necessary. You could have used a paint remover of just sand blasted it. Then some powder coating would do a proper job here. Or just buy another set.
    Have not seen you checking the steering, brakes, brake fluid, oil change and so many more to be done before selling it for 3800 P/Sterling.
